The Hospital of Saint Raphael or Saint Raphael Hospital, located in New Haven, Connecticut, United States, was a 511-bed community teaching hospital founded by the Sisters of Charity of Saint Elizabeth in 1907. On September 12, 2012, Yale-New Haven Hospital acquired Saint Raphael and converted into the Yale-New Haven Hospital Saint Raphael Campus. In 1907, the Sisters of Charity of Saint Elizabeth came to New Haven to start the hospital at the request of a group of local physicians, led by Dr. William F. Verdi. The doctors asked the Sisters of Charity to administer a hospital that would "receive and care for all patients who might apply for admission without regard to creed or race: To extend charity to the sick, poor, and to offer the institution to those of the medical profession who desire to care for their own patients".
